  • Publication number: 20240043366
    Abstract: Disclosed is a catalyst based on synthetic silica, in a heterogeneous catalysis method, to promote the effective conversion of residual glycerin, resulting from the production of biodiesel, into formic acid with high selectivity and stability, in a continuous flow reaction. The conversion of residual glycerin occurs by homogeneous catalysis, by the action of components remaining from the synthesis of biodiesel, with the formation of major compounds, such as formic acid, cyclic ethers and diglycerol, in continuous flow and reflow reactions. The reaction can also be carried out by adding sodium salts in the homogeneous catalytic conversion process of commercial glycerin. The process values the residual glycerin, without the need for purification before its transformation into products with high added value, but of renewable origin, adding more interest and potential.

  • Publication number: 20230080299
    Abstract: A teeth whitening based on the generation of active oxygen in the form of oxygen radical species in situ and method for producing the whitening gel which has modified niobium compounds and its activity maximized if applied with hydrogen peroxide in low concentrations, with stabilization by a thickener. The whitening gel can be used without light treatment and with greater efficiency than commercial products and with a significant potential to reduce side effects. The whitening toothpaste and gels including modified niobium compounds associated with cations, the mechanisms of whitening action comes from electronic excitation, from the incidence of radiation on niobium compounds with cations, due to the action of the functional chemical groups present in the nanoparticles, even in the absence of light. In addition, the compounds can act as chemical whiteners, leading to a decrease in caries bacteria due to the oxidant functional groups in the nanoparticles.
